To find two numbers that multiply to equal 5005, you can factor 5005. The prime factorization of 5005 is 5 x 7 x 11 x 13. Therefore, several pairs of numbers can be multiplied to yield 5005, such as 65 and 77 (since 65 x 77 = 5005).

To find which times tables equal 160, you can look for pairs of factors that multiply to 160. For example, 10 times 16 equals 160, as does 8 times 20, and 5 times 32. Other combinations include 4 times 40 and 2 times 80. Thus, the times tables that yield 160 can be expressed through these factor pairs.
